'Clarinet/Bassoon/Oboe - Radio Caprice' is an online radio station that specializes in classical music featuring the sounds of the clarinet, bassoon, and oboe. Whether you’re a fan of these woodwind instruments or simply looking to explore their enchanting melodies, this radio station offers a range of beautiful compositions to captivate your ears.
With a diverse selection of tracks from renowned composers and lesser-known gems, 'Clarinet/Bassoon/Oboe - Radio Caprice' takes listeners on a journey through the exquisite sounds of these woodwind instruments. From the soothing and melancholic tones of the clarinet to the warm and expressive melodies of the oboe, this radio station allows for an immersive and captivating experience.
The station provides a platform for both established musicians and emerging talent, offering a blend of solo performances, ensemble pieces, and orchestral arrangements. Whether you're in the mood for the enchanting melodies of a solo clarinet or the harmonious interplay between multiple woodwind instruments, this radio station has it all.
'Clarinet/Bassoon/Oboe - Radio Caprice' is the perfect destination for fans of classical music or those looking to expand their musical horizons. Its focus on the clarinet, bassoon, and oboe sets it apart from other classical music radio stations, allowing listeners to appreciate the unique qualities of these woodwind instruments.
Whether you're a music enthusiast, a musician looking for inspiration, or simply seeking a moment of tranquillity, 'Clarinet/Bassoon/Oboe - Radio Caprice' provides a sonically rich experience that is sure to enthrall and captivate. Tune in and let the beautiful sounds of these woodwind instruments transport you to a world of musical elegance and expressiveness.
